When some of the berries started to soften, I tossed them into the blender with ice, lime juice and a touch of raw sugar and made a slushy. It reminded me of other frozen drinks I’ve made but felt even more refreshing since it worked for daytime sipping.

Frozen Blackberry Limeade

Frozen blackberry limeade by @DessertForTwo

Frozen lemonade gets a bright upgrade with fresh blackberries and lime juice—quick to make and perfect for a hot day.

Prep Time
3 minutes
Total Time
3 minutes

Ingredients

  • 6 ounces fresh blackberries
  • 2 tablespoons raw sugar (or honey or granulated sugar)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ice
  • 2 cups crushed ice

Instructions

  1. Combine blackberries, sugar, lime juice and crushed ice in a high-speed blender. Blend until smooth and slushy.
  2. Serve immediately. If making ahead, allow for thawing and pulse again in the blender before serving.
